BMP Image
Source formatBMP is an uncompressed raster image format native to Windows. Files are large but preserve exact pixel data with no compression artifacts. Rarely used on the web due to file size.
Digital Moving-Picture
Target formatDPX (Digital Picture Exchange) is a SMPTE standard file format for digital intermediate and visual effects work. It stores per-frame image data with rich metadata for color management and is widely used in film post-production pipelines.

BMP vs DPX — Strengths and limitations
What each format does best, and where it falls short.
BMP Strengths
- Dead-simple format — trivially easy to read and write.
- Lossless and uncompressed — perfect bit-exact pixel storage.
- Universally supported in Windows applications since 1985.
- Supports 1, 4, 8, 16, 24, and 32-bit color depths.
Limitations
- Enormous file sizes — no meaningful compression in typical use.
- Not a web format — browsers support it but nobody serves BMPs over HTTP.
- No metadata support (no EXIF, no ICC profile in practice).
DPX Strengths
- Industry-standard archival format for film.
- Logarithmic color encoding preserves film look.
- Lossless — no generation degradation.
- SMPTE standardized (SMPTE 268M).
- Every VFX and color-grading app reads and writes DPX.
Limitations
- No compression — file sizes are enormous.
- Not a display format — requires color-managed pipelines.
- Gradually superseded by OpenEXR in modern VFX.
BMP vs DPX — Technical specifications
Side-by-side comparison of the technical details.
BMP
- MIME type
- image/bmp
- Extensions
- .bmp, .dib
- Compression
- None (typical); RLE 4/8 bit (rare)
- Color depths
- 1, 4, 8, 16, 24, 32 bits per pixel
- Byte order
- Little-endian
DPX
- MIME type
- image/x-dpx
- Extension
- .dpx
- Standard
- SMPTE 268M
- Bit depths
- 8, 10, 12, 16 bits per channel
- Color encoding
- Logarithmic (Cineon-style) by convention

BMP vs DPX — Typical file sizes
Approximate file sizes for common scenarios.
BMP
- Small icon (32×32) 4 KB
- Screenshot (1920×1080) ~6 MB
- 4K image (3840×2160) ~25 MB
- Scanned A4 at 300 dpi ~25 MB
DPX
- 2K DPX frame (2048×1556, 10-bit) ~12 MB
- 4K DPX frame (4096×3112, 10-bit) ~50 MB
- 90-min feature at 4K DPX sequence ~6 TB
